When I use a formula as the "true" in excel, the formula is displayed as the
answer rather than the result of the formula. How can I amend this? The true
answer is "sum(e6*$e$40). I am trying to calculate the discount given if an
order is over a certain sum
 
J

JE McGimpsey

Make sure you're not putting the TRUE formula in quotes (quotes are only
needed for Text):

=IF(TRUE,SUM(E6*$E$40),"")
